LS2 SS Trailblazer Dyno Yet?
Has anyone gotten one of these on the dyno yet? Just curious how much of the LS2 power is geting to the ground. I know the C6's are in the 350 range.

The truck is AWD so you won't see car type numbers. We ran one today, it made around 300/300 at all 4 wheels. It only had 1XX miles on it. It ran a 1/4 sim in 13.9 seconds.
